People with massive amounts data to store and feature in websites have a definite need of a computer system to do these things. However, the cost of equipment can sometimes prohibit such acquisitions, especially for start-up or non-profit applications. For these people, webhosting options are likely the best course of action. Some providers offer resources that cater to this small scale operations at much cheaper costs. Some even offer free use of Software that can really help in low budget situations. However, providers also typically provide high end resource allocations for sites and databases that have grown with time and success. Thus, webhosting is really a good alternative to purchasing and maintaining a dedicated server.

Also, the best thing about webhosting is the Security it provides. Note that some clients share a single computer system and anything that happens to one, like a hostile virus infiltration can spread to others. Thus, it is the business of providers to assure the safe existence and operation of all client owned system.
